I'm posting this for the guy who bought my '79 project from me. He had purchased another '79 before this and the frame and birdcage were toast. He has taken my birdcage and frame (I gave up on it because it was rotted) and is going to attach his panels to it or something like that Anyway. He sent me pictures of my birdcage and the birdcage of his other '79. Both have the three compartment storage in the back so are of the same vintage. On his there is a complete metal panel across where the dash would go, whereas on the one he got from me, there are the three "clips" that the dash attaches to. Is this on his, with 40+ spotwelds, something someone else has done or is it factory and mine was hacked up? My '73 does not have this complete panel across..

Hi K,
From the intricate 'formed' details in the long piece, it appears to me to be something that was done at St.Louis.
There was a situation similar to this in 68-69 when the dash braces were added to convertibles. The mounting tabs added to the cages for the braces at first seemed to appear sporadically as though a supply of cages with out the tabs were being used up.
